Song Origins: One Arm Steve
Hi [Burnthday], your message found me well and living in Ireland. Sorry to say my Panic photos are stashed away in the US. But to the "story"; where to start? I was working as a stage hand for the BIG Panic show on Washington Street; knowing that there was going to be a hugh crowd, I figured that was the best way to be able to see and enjoy the show. Just before the 2nd set, Garo Vereen found me and said that the boys wanted to see me before they went back on stage. I went over to the entrance of the 40 Watt and the guys all circled around me. They then asked if it would be alright by me if they played a new song called "One Arm Steve". I said yes, no worries and went back to my spot stage left. Michael Stipe came up and stood next to me as Panic started the 2nd set with "One Arm Steve". Now to how it all came to be: Panic was playing a show at the GA Theatre, it was a sell out, all kinds of people were trying every trick in the book to get in. T Lavitz was sitting at the bar, his Hammond organ was on stage, Jo Jo had played the night before with Beanland. Things are starting to get busy, it is almost time for the band to start when Jo Jo comes up to the door where I was taking tickets and tried to come in, I stopped him, he had no ticket and he wasn't on the guest list. He said he was in the band and I pointed to the promo picture of Panic that we had taped to the box office window and said "Come back when your picture's on the wall", and would not let him in. Then Dave came up from behind me and told me that Jo Jo was the band's new keyboard player. Then Jo Jo was allowed to join the band."
- One-Armed Steve Fleming
